A 2D C++ game engine built using SFML and ImGui.
Currently following the COMP4300 course on YouTube
Make sure you have CMake.
-
Clone the
vcpkg
repository:git clone https://github.com/microsoft/vcpkg.git
-
Run
vcpkg
bootstrap script:cd vcpkg ./bootstrap-vcpkg.sh
-
Install SFML and ImGUI:
./vcpkg install sfml imgui
Use CMake to generate the build files and build the project:
mkdir build
cd build
cmake ..
cmake --build .
Run the compiled executable:
./GameEngine